The material S690G4QL belongs to the material group "High Strength Steels". We also have the chemical analysis of S690G4QL available for you below. Material "S690G4QL" is made of Boron, Carbon, Chrome, Manganese, Molybdenum, Nickel, Phosphorus, Silicon, Sulfur and Vanadium. Steel-Material: S690G4QL (DIN/EN)

Steel Material S690G4QL - Chemical Analysis
- Carbon (C%)0,12-0,21
- Silicon (Si%)0,20-0,35
- Manganese (Mn%)0,95-1,30
- Phosphorus (P%)0,025
- Sulfur (S%)0,025

- Chrome (Cr%)0,40-0,65

- Molybdenum (Mo%)0,20-0,30

- Nickel (Ni%)0,30-0,70

- Vanadium (V%)0,03-0,08

- Boron (B%)≥0,0005
